About the role
We are seeking a skilled Carpenter/all-round trade to join our growing team at Redrock maintenance located throughout the Kimberley region, Western Australia. This role would suit self-employed individual with own vehicle and tools and be responsible for providing high-quality carpentry, property maintenance and cabinet-making services to our residential and commercial clients in town and remote communities in East and West Kimberley.
What you'll be doing
- Undertaking a variety of carpentry tasks, including lock changes, hanging doors, finishing, patching and installing cabinets and other woodwork
- Reading and interpreting blueprints, plans, and technical specifications to ensure accurate project execution
- Performing preventative maintenance and repairs on existing structures and furniture
- Collaborating with clients, project managers, and other tradespeople to ensure successful project completion
- Maintaining a safe and tidy work environment, adhering to all relevant health and safety regulations
- Providing mentorship and on-the-job training to junior members of the team
What we're looking for
- Proven experience as a Carpenter, with a min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ience in the trades and services industry
- Driving license
- Strong technical skills and knowledge of carpentry techniques, tools, and materials
- Ability to read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, and specifications
- Excellent problem-solving and critical thinking skills to troubleshoot and find creative solutions
- Commitment to safety and a strong attention to detail
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to work collaboratively with clients and colleagues
- Certificate III in Carpentry or equivalent qualification desirable but not needed for right candidate
